import java.io.IOException;
import java.util.List;
import org.dstadler.jgit.helper.CookbookHelper;
import org.eclipse.jgit.api.Git;
import org.eclipse.jgit.api.errors.GitAPIException;
import org.eclipse.jgit.lib.Ref;
import org.eclipse.jgit.lib.Repository;
/**
* Simple snippet which shows how to create and delete branches
*
* @author dominik.stadler at gmx.at
*/
public class CreateAndDeleteBranch {
public static void main(String[] args) throws IOException, GitAPIException {
// prepare test-repository
Repository repository = CookbookHelper.openJGitCookbookRepository();
Git git = new Git(repository);
List<Ref> call = new Git(repository).branchList().call();
for (Ref ref : call) {
System.out.println("Branch-Before: " + ref + " " + ref.getName() + " " + ref.getObjectId().getName());
}
// run the add-call
git.branchCreate()
.setName("testbranch")
.call();
call = new Git(repository).branchList().call();
for (Ref ref : call) {
System.out.println("Branch-Created: " + ref + " " + ref.getName() + " " + ref.getObjectId().getName());
}
// run the delete-call
git.branchDelete()
.setBranchNames("testbranch")
.call();
call = new Git(repository).branchList().call();
for (Ref ref : call) {
System.out.println("Branch-After: " + ref + " " + ref.getName() + " " + ref.getObjectId().getName());
}
repository.close();
}
}
